the long version

One of the towering figures of modern Japanese writing, Akutagawa's early career was distinguished by imaginative, beautifully crafted stories of medieval Japan, rich with period detail. These two stories include his great masterpiece of that period, Hell Screen, and the parable of a thread-thin chance of escape for a sinner in the Pool of Blood.
